How To Choose The Best Brazilian Curly Hair Products
Choosing the right product for your curls is about matching the formulation to your hair’s specific needs—its porosity, density, and curl pattern. A product that works beautifully for loose waves may completely flatten tight coils, while an ultra-rich butter blend could leave fine curls looking greasy. Here’s what to focus on.
Understand Your Curl Porosity and Density
High-porosity hair (which absorbs water quickly but loses moisture fast) benefits from heavier ingredients like shea butter and oils that seal the cuticle. Low-porosity hair needs lighter humectants like aloe vera or glycerin to avoid product buildup that leads to stiffness. Check the Formulation: Silicones, Sulfates, and Parabens
Many high-quality Brazilian formulations are silicone-free, which prevents the plastic-like coating that can build up on curls. They rely on natural oils like coconut, argan, or macadamia nut oil for slip and shine instead. Avoid sulfates (SLS) as they strip natural oils, and parabens which are preservatives linked to scalp irritation. Match Product Weight to Your Styling Routine
If you air-dry or use a diffuser, a lighter leave-in conditioner provides moisture without extending drying time. For twist-outs or braid-outs, a thicker curl cream with more hold (like the Salon Line Maximum Definition) gives better definition.
